Learn the core principles of Good Manufacturing Practices in food production.
While basic food safety relates to restaurants,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P) govern massive, industrial-scale food production. This 'Food Safety: GMP in the Food Industry' certificate teaches you the rigorous quality assurance protocols used in modern food processing plants. A single error in a factory can result in thousands of contaminated products reaching consumers, leading to massive financial losses and reputational ruin. You will learn how to design factory layouts that prevent cross-contamination, how to implement strict preventive maintenance programs for industrial equipment, and how to manage the complex logistics of raw material traceability. The course also heavily emphasizes the role of the employee in maintaining a sterile manufacturing environment, covering specialized gowning procedures and controlled access zones.
